1. 首页
  2. 编程语言
  3. C++ 
  4. 线段树例题之——sort.cpp

线段树例题之——sort.cpp

上传者: 2021-03-18 12:44:48上传 CPP文件 3.92KB 热度 10次
T1 本题极其无聊,3T强行捏成1T,差最大 显然是 前一半后一半,差最小显然是间隔着放,方案数显然是卡特兰数列 关于卡特兰数列,直接放公式了h(n)=C(2n,n)/(n+1) (n=0,1,2,...) or h(n)=c(2n,n)-c(2n,n-1)(n=0,1,2,...) 也就是2n 个数0 1,保证在任何位置都有:之前的1的个数
用户评论